Scholars’ Education Trust (SET) is seeking an exceptional leader to join our Executive Team as Senior Co-
Chief Executive Officer, guiding our diverse family of schools into the next stage of growth and excellence.

This is a rare and exciting opportunity to shape the future of a successful and expanding multi-academy
trust.

SET is a cross-phase trust of thirteen schools across Hertfordshire, Bedfordshire and West Essex,
educating nearly 10,000 pupils from nursery through to sixth form.
Our vision is clear: to work collaboratively so that every young person in our care achieves more than they
ever believed possible. Our values: Achievement, Care and Excellence (ACE), underpin everything we do.
We are looking for a strategic and inspirational leader who shares our commitment to improving
standards and outcomes for all pupils. The successful candidate will have a proven track record of
leadership at scale, with the ability to drive educational excellence, foster innovation, and build strong
relationships with stakeholders. They will bring the vision and resilience to lead a complex organisation,
ensuring sustainability and growth while maintaining the highest standards of governance and
accountability.

As Senior Co-CEO, you will:

  • Provide strategic leadership across the Trust, working in partnership with Trustees, Headteachers
    and civic partners.
  • Champion educational excellence and inclusion, ensuring every child receives a high-quality
    education.
  • Lead the School Improvement Team and act as the Trust’s Accounting Officer, upholding probity
    and compliance.
  • Shape and deliver a people strategy that attracts, develops and retains outstanding staff.
  • Represent SET nationally and locally, influencing policy and promoting our civic mission.
  • The job description and responsibilities of the current Senior Co-CEO of SET will form the basis of the role.
    We are, however, willing to be flexible and would be open to a discussion with the successful candidate
    about the exact scope of the jobs, its responsibilities, and its hours.
    You will be supported by a highly experienced Executive Team and a committed Board of Trustees, as well
    as a collaborative network of schools that share best practice and innovation.
